==============
Kolibri README
==============
This Ansible role installs `Kolibri <https://learningequality.org/kolibri/>`_ within `Internet-in-a-Box (IIAB) <http://internet-in-a-box.org/>`_. Kolibri is an open-source educational platform specially designed to provide offline access to a wide range of quality, openly licensed educational contents in low-resource contexts like rural schools, refugee camps, orphanages, and also in non-formal school programs.
Kolibri's online User Guide is here: `https://kolibri.readthedocs.io <https://kolibri.readthedocs.io/>`_
Using It
--------
If enabled and with the default settings, Kolibri should be accessible at: http://box/kolibri
To login to Kolibri enter::
Username: Admin
Password: changeme

Automatic Device Provisioning
-----------------------------
When kolibri_provision is enabled (e.g. in `/etc/iiab/local_vars.yml <http://FAQ.IIAB.IO#What_is_local_vars.yml_and_how_do_I_customize_it.3F>`_) the installation will set up the following defaults::
Kolibri Facility name: 'Kolibri-in-a-Box'
Kolibri Preset type: formal # Options: formal, nonformal, informal
Kolibri default language: en # Options: ar, bn-bd, en, es-es, fa, fr-fr, hi-in, mr, nyn, pt-br, sw-tz, ta, te, ur-pk, yo, zu
Kolibri Admin username: Admin
Kolibri Admin password: changeme
*Feel free to override any of the above, by copying the relevant line from /opt/iiab/iiab/roles/kolibri/defaults/main.yml to /etc/iiab/local_vars.yml (then run 'cd /opt/iiab/iiab' followed by './runrole kolibri' per IIAB's general guidelines at http://FAQ.IIAB.IO).*
Cloning Content
---------------
Kolibri 0.10 introduced ``kolibri manage deprovision`` which will remove user configurations, leaving content intact — i.e. if student and teacher privacy requires their records be deleted. You can then copy or clone /library/kolibri to a new location, or to a new school entirely.
Troubleshooting
---------------
You can run the server manually with the following commands::
systemctl stop kolibri # Make sure the systemd service is not running
export KOLIBRI_HOME=/library/kolibri
export KOLIBRI_HTTP_PORT=8009 # Otherwise Kolibri will try to run on default port 8080
kolibri start
To return to using the systemd unit file::
kolibri stop
systemctl start kolibri
Known Issues
------------
* Kolibri migrations can take a long time on a Raspberry Pi. These long-running migrations could cause kolibri service timeouts. Try running migrations manually using command ``kolibri manage migrate`` after following the troubleshooting instructions above. Kolibri developers are trying to address this issue. (See `learningequality/kolibri#4310 <https://github.com/learningequality/kolibri/issues/4310>`_)
* Loading channels can take a long time on a Raspberry Pi. When generating channel contents for Khan Academy, the step indicated as “Generating channel listing. This could take a few minutes…” could mean ~30 minutes. The device’s computation power is the bottleneck. You might get logged out while waiting, but this is harmless and the process will continue. Sit tight!
